Charter One buys iMacs for schools

updated 12:20 pm EDT, Mon May 7, 2001

 
", 0, 0);


Charter One Financial has launched a new program where the bank will make a contribution to the 'One-Click' fund each time a Charter One customer signs up to bank online. The fund will then be used to purchase iMacs and printers for schools. Participating schools are located in select cities in Massachusetts, Michigan, New York, Ohio, and Vermont.
